Ingredients and Preparation

Essential Ingredients and Possible Substitutions

To create your own flavorful Apple Arugula Salad, here are the essential ingredients you’ll need:

  • Arugula: Fresh, young arugula adds a tender, peppery flavor. If you can’t find fresh arugula, baby spinach works as a lovely alternative.
  • Apples: Crisp, sweet-tart varieties like Honeycrisp, Fuji, or Granny Smith are ideal. They add a natural sweetness that balances the arugula’s bite.
  • Nuts: Walnuts or pecans provide a delightful crunch. If you prefer, toasted almonds or sunflower seeds make excellent substitutes.
  • Cheese: A tangy cheese like goat or feta ties all the flavors together beautifully. If you want to keep it dairy-free, you can skip this altogether or opt for nutritional yeast for a hint of umami.
  • Fresh Herbs: Chopped fresh herbs like parsley or mint can elevate your salad’s flavor profile. Feel free to experiment with whatever you have on hand.
  • Dressing Ingredients: Extra virgin olive oil, lemon juice, honey, salt, and pepper form a simple yet delicious dressing. Maple syrup can replace honey for a vegan option.

This salad is adaptable! If you’re in the mood, add seasonal ingredients like pears in the fall or berries in the summer, allowing you to enjoy various fresh flavors throughout the year.

Step-by-Step Recipe Instructions with Tips

  1. Prep the Ingredients: Start by washing the arugula thoroughly and drying it. If you’re using apples with skins, chop them into bite-sized pieces—no need to peel. If you prefer, thinly slice them for a more elegant touch.

  2. Toast the Nuts: In a skillet over medium heat, toast your nuts until fragrant, about 5 minutes. Keep an eye on them; they can burn quickly!

  3. Make the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together 3 tablespoons of olive oil, 1 tablespoon of lemon juice, a drizzle of honey, and salt and pepper to taste. Adjust to your preferred level of acidity and sweetness.

  4. Assemble the Salad: In a large bowl, toss the arugula with the apples, nuts, and cheese. Drizzle over the dressing and give everything a gentle toss to combine.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.

  5. Serve Immediately: This salad is best enjoyed fresh, so serve it right away, adorned with a sprinkle of fresh herbs for that pop of color and flavor!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using Expired Greens: Check your arugula for freshness. Wilted greens won’t provide that delightful crunch.
  • Cutting Apples Too Early: Apples can brown quickly when exposed to air. Prepare them just before adding them to the salad or toss them with a bit of lemon juice to maintain vibrancy.
  • Ignoring Texture: Balance is key! Ensure a mix of crunchy nuts, creamy cheese, and fresh greens for the best experience.

How do I store leftover Apple Arugula Salad?
Store any leftover sal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Keep the dressing separate to avoid soggy greens. Consume within a day for the best flavor and texture.

Can I freeze Apple Arugula Salad?
Freezing this salad isn’t ideal due to the fresh greens. Specifically, arugula doesn’t hold up well under freezing conditions. It’s best to enjoy it fresh, but you can freeze the dressing and use it later.

Description

A refreshing Apple Arugula Salad bursting with flavors, combining crisp apples with peppery arugula, topped with a simple homemade dressing.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 cups fresh arugula
  • 2 crisp apples (Honeycrisp, Fuji, or Granny Smith)
  • 1/2 cup walnuts or pecans (optional)
  • 1/2 cup feta or goat cheese (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on honey
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h herbs (parsley or mint, optional)

Instructions

  1. Prep the ingredients: Wash and dry the arugula, chop the apples into bite-sized pieces.
  2. Toast the nuts: In a skillet over medium heat, toast nuts until fragrant, about 5 minutes.
  3. Make the dressing: Wh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, honey, salt, and pepper in a small bowl.
  4. Assemble the salad: Toss arugula with apples, nuts, and cheese in a large bowl, drizzling with dressing.
  5. Serve immediately: Enjoy the salad fresh, garnished with fresh herbs if desired.

Notes

For a vegan option, replace honey with maple syrup and skip the cheese. Seasonal fruits can be added for variety.
